Little League Seniors take championship15-2 GAME ENDS RUN FOR RED ROCK CREWSpecial to the PVT
The Pahrump Valley Little League Senior Division team has managed to defeat the odds. But in Tuesday's championship District 4 game, the 15-2 victory over Red Rock was anything but the blow-out indicated by the lopsided score. Cody Nielsen struck out six batters, walked four and another three were hit by pitches. For Red Rock, the pitchers had a tough time controlling the zone and managed to clout a total of nine batters. Nielsen led the Pahrump gang with three RBIs and was followed by Tyler Lepley with two and Mike Gonzalez, Ronnie Torres and Ethan Wald, each of whom brought in a runner to give Pahrump the edge and finish the district season as top dogs. The last title held was in 2002 under Rich Lauver's reign. With outstanding pitching, hard hitting and teamwork in all three final games, the boys are now ready for their next challenge: They head for the state tournament this weekend at Silverado Ranch Park on Gillispie Road in Las Vegas, where they will face Central Little League. This will be a best-of-three tournament, and if Pahrump wins, the home team will head north to Salem, Ore., to defend the state title for the regionals. Game times are Friday, July 20, at 7 p.m.; Saturday the 21st at 7 p.m.; and, if needed, July 22 at 7 p.m. All games will be on Silverado's North Field. |
